Abstract

The present invention relates to a method for the production of a combined piezo/luminescent film for use as actuating element, especially in vehicles, comprising the steps: provision of a film-type base material (); application of a piezoelectric varnish () onto the base material at least in a first partial area (A, A) so as to form a piezoelectric switch surface in the first partial area; application of a luminescent varnish () onto the base material in at least a second partial area (B, B) so as to be able to illuminate the switch surface in the second partial area; covering at least of the first and second partial area with a top layer () that is bonded to the base material. In addition, the present invention describes an actuating element with a combined piezo/luminescent film produced in such a manner.
